#8bac6c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8bac6c is composed of 54.5% red, 67.5%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.2%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 90.9 degrees, a saturation of 27.8% and a lightness of 54.9%. #8bac6c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d8 with #175900.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#8bac6c color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.

#8bac6c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8bac6c has RGB values of R:139, G:172,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 9153644.

Shades and Tints of #8bac6c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030302 is the darkest color, while #f8faf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8bac6c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c9187 is the less saturated color, while #89fc1c is the most saturated one.
